The Art of Precision
Maddux revolutionized pitching by proving that strategy can outperform strength. His style focused on control, deception, and psychological pressure. He used the strike zone like a chessboard, placing pitches where hitters were weakest.

Instead of overpowering batters, he outplayed them mentally. His ability to mix pitches and control ball action made him nearly impossible to predict. This approach turned every at-bat into a mental duel that he often won.

Mental Toughness and Baseball IQ
What truly set Maddux apart was his baseball intelligence. He approached every game like a strategist. He studied hitters, learned their patterns, and exploited their mistakes.

This mental toughness allowed him to remain calm under stress. In crucial moments, he relied not on force but on focus. His ability to stay composed made him nearly unbeatable in high-stakes situations.
